- Did you mean
- 35 insert good sit
- 35 instra good suit
- Related search terms
- goods+官+网+⏩+推+荐+㊙️+t
- instra taxabl stress
- good fc cover websit
- good fc coyot websit
- good fc come websit
-
BP2100G1 PCB£649.00
-
BHT One Spray£41.00
